St. Hilaire City Park

Looking for a convenient launch point in northern Minnesota? St. Hilaire City Park offers public access to the Red Lake River, managed by the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ources. Located in Saint Hilaire in Pennington County, this ramp is a solid option if you're planning to get out on the water in the area.
